Teledyne FLIR Marine, a division of Teledyne Technologies, has released the FLIR M364C-USV, a multispectral maritime camera system. This new system is specifically engineered to support autonomous and uncrewed surface vessels (USVs) in navigating safely, identifying potential hazards more quickly, and maintaining comprehensive situational awareness in demanding marine environments. The camera integrates both thermal and visible imaging capabilities.
